Table 3-2 Encoding Configurations
Setting Description
Channel Select a channel from the dropdown list
Code Stream Type Select from Main Stream, Motion Stream, and Alarm
Stream. You can select different encoding frame rates for
different recorded events.
The NVR system supports active control frame function (ACF),
which allows you to record in different frame rates.
For example, you can use a high frame rate to record
important events, and configure a lower frame rate for
recording scheduled events. ACF allows you to set different
frame rates for motion detection recording and alarm
recording.
Video Enable Click to enable the extra video stream. Enabled by default.
Compression The main bit stream supports H.264. The extra stream
supports H.264 and MJPG.
